Guwahati beat Silchar

By Sports reporter

GUWAHATI, March 9 � Guwahati handed a seven-wicket drubbing to Silchar in a semifinal league match of the Senior Inter District Cricket Tournament (Elite) for the Nuruddin Ahmed Trophy at the Barsapara stadium here today. On the second day of the three-day match, requiring 111 for victory in the second innings, Guwahati reached the target losing three wickets.

Brief scores: Silchar 1st innings 62. Guwahati 1st Innings 169. Silchar 2nd Innings 217 (Ambar Bhattacharjee 44, Raihan Jamil Mazumder 40, Mihir Kanti Deb 36, Abhishek Thakur 29, Raju Das 19, Abir Chakraborty 3/57, Sadek Imran Choudhury 3/53). Guwahati 2nd Innings 111/3 (Sunu Kumar 43, Avijit Singha Roy 31, Rahul Hazarika 28, Mihir Kanti Deb 2/28).

Nagaon on verge of victory vs Dibrugarh: At the NF Railway Stadium, Maligaon today, Nagaon are on verge of victory against Dibrugarh. On the second day of the three-day league match, in reply to Nagaon�s first innings total of 363, Dibrugarh were all out for 111. Following on, Dibrugarh were 137 for the loss of five wickets.

Brief scores: Nagaon 1st Innings 363. Dibrugarh 1st Innings 111 (Salim Ahmed 26, Prasanta Sonowal 20, Jyotiraditya Chetia 14, Sourav Bhagawati 14, Mrinmoy Dutta 4/14, Bitop Mahanta 4/54). Dibrugarh 2nd Innings (following on) 137/5 (Ripunjoy Dutta 35, Prasanta Sonowal 32, Jyotiraditya Chetia 30, Amit Sinha 2/31, Bichitra Baruah 2/30).
